@import "flashMessages.css";
@import "MattBlackTabs.css";
@import "confirmform.css";

                  

body {

	padding: 10px;
  font-family:   Verdana, Calibri, 'Arial CE', 'Helvetica CE', Arial, sans-serif;
	font-size: 0.8em;

    background-image: url(../../../images/css/admin/admin_bg_body.png);
    background-repeat: repeat;
	color:#1C4C73;

}



a:visited {
  font-size:14px;
  font-family:   Verdana, Calibri, 'Arial CE', 'Helvetica CE', Arial, sans-serif;
  color: #5C9DD3;
  font-family:   Verdana, Calibri, 'Arial CE', 'Helvetica CE', Arial, sans-serif;
  color: #FF7100;
  font-weight:bold;
  text-decoration: none
}



a:link {
  font-size:14px;
  font-family:   Verdana, Calibri, 'Arial CE', 'Helvetica CE', Arial, sans-serif;
  color: #5C9DD3;
  font-weight:bold;
  text-decoration: none
}





H1 {

  text-align:left;

  margin-left:5px;

  =margin-top:10px;

  FONT-SIZE: 16px;

  COLOR: #F07200;

  BACKGROUND-COLOR: transparent;

  font-family:  Verdana, Calibri, 'Arial CE', 'Helvetica CE', Arial, sans-serif;

  z-index:5;



}



H2 {

  text-align:left;

  margin-left:5px;

  =margin-top:10px;

  FONT-SIZE: 14px;

  COLOR: #9F4B00;

  BACKGROUND-COLOR: transparent;

  font-family:  Verdana, Calibri, 'Arial CE', 'Helvetica CE', Arial, sans-serif;

  z-index:5;



}









#web {



  margin: auto;

  width: 1100px;

  background-color: #7A7A7A;

  border-top: 5px solid #FF882B ;

  border-bottom: 5px solid #FF882B;



  border-left: 1px solid #FF882B ;

  border-right: 1px solid #FF882B;



}





#head {



    float:left;

    width: 1100px;

    height:140px;

   background-color:#414141;

    color:white;



}

#login{

  float:right;

  width: 350px;

  height:70px;

  color: orange;

  background-color:  #414141;

  text-align:center;

  border-bottom:1px solid  orange;



}



#logout{

  float:right;

}





/* #menu{

    width:1100px;

    float: left;

    height:40px;

    background-color: #FFFFFF;

    color:white;

    z-index:2;

    border-bottom: 1px solid #245F8E

}*/



#left{

    float:left;

    width:200px;

    background-color: #7A7A7A;

    min-height: 600px;

}

#left a {
  font-size:14px;
  font-family:   Verdana, Calibri, 'Arial CE', 'Helvetica CE', Arial, sans-serif;
  color: #EAEAEA;
  font-weight:bold;
  text-decoration: none
}
#left a.visited {
  font-size:14px;
  font-family:   Verdana, Calibri, 'Arial CE', 'Helvetica CE', Arial, sans-serif;
  color: #EAEAEA;
  font-weight:bold;
  text-decoration: none
}

#left a:hover {
  font-size:14px;
  font-family:   Verdana, Calibri, 'Arial CE', 'Helvetica CE', Arial, sans-serif;
  color: #FF7100;
  font-weight:bold;
  text-decoration: none
}



#left li{list-style-image: url(../../images/css/admin/bullet.png); margin-top:10px}

#right{

    float:right;

    width:200px;

    background-color: #666666;

     min-height: 300px;

}





#center{
    width:899px;
    padding-top:20px;
    background-color: #F8F8F8;
    border-left:1px solid orange;
    float:left;
    color:#000000;
    min-height: 580px;
}



#pata{

    width:1100px;

    height:25px;

    background-color:#414141;

    color:#EAEAEA;

    text-align:center;

    border-top: 1px solid orange;

    z-index:2;

}



#pata a{

font-size:12px;

font-weight: normal;

    color:#FFA500;

}

#pata a.visited{

font-weight: normal;

font-size:12px;

    color:#FFA500;

}

#pata a:hover{

font-weight: normal;

font-size:12px;

    color:#FFA500;

}



#admin_login{

	width: 300px;

	margin: 0 auto;

    color: black;

    background-color:#EAEAEA;

    text-align:center;

    }



.clearboth{

    clear:both;

}





.nb{border:0px;}





table.polozky_v_menu{

  width:80%;

  margin:auto;

      text-align:center;

  border-collapse: collapse;

}



table.polozky_v_menu thead{

background-color:#245F8E;



text-align:center;

font-weight:bold;

  color: white

}



tr.sub1{

background-color:#87B6DC;

}

tr.sub2{

background-color:#C0D9ED;

}

tr.sub3{

background-color:#EDF4FA;

}

tr.sub4{

background-color:#E0E0E0;



}



td.sub1{

font-weight:bold

}

td.sub2{

text-indent:20px;

}

td.sub3{

text-indent:40px;

}

td.sub4{

text-indent:60px;

}



.center{

  text-align:center;

}



.error{

  font-weight: bold;

  color: red;

  font-size: 20px

}

p.pata{

  margin-top: 3px;

}

table tr.left th{

  text-align:left

}



#center fieldset{

  width:84%;

  margin:auto

}



img.logo_webco{

  margin-top:27px;

  margin-left:30px;

}

img.logo_login{

  margin:auto;

  margin-top:10px;

}



table.nahledy_obrazku{

 width:77%;

 text-align:center;

 margin:auto;

 border-collapse: collapse;

}



table.nahledy_obrazku thead{

color:white;

background-color:#245F8E

}



table.nahledy_obrazku thead{

color:white;

background-color:#245F8E

}



table.nahledy_obrazku tbody tr,

table.nahledy_obrazku thead tr{

border:1px solid black;

}











table.nahledy_obrazku tbody td{

background-color:#EBF0FA;

}















table.orders{

border:1px solid black;

margin:auto;

text-align:center;

width:95%

}



table.orders tbody tr{

border-top:1px solid black;

border-bottom:1px solid black;}



table.orders thead{

  font-weight:bold;

  background-color: #245F8E;

  color:white;

}











table.editOrder{

border:1px solid black;

margin:auto;

text-align:center;

width:86%

}



table.editOrder tbody tr{

border-top:1px solid black;

border-bottom:1px solid black;}



table.editOrder thead{

  font-weight:bold;

  background-color: #245F8E;

  color:white;

}











img{

  border:0px;

}





table.variants{

  border-collapse:collapsed;

  margin:auto;

  width:77%;

  text-align:center;

  border: 2px solid #164F7C;

}

table.variants thead{

   font-weight:bold;

  background-color: #245F8E;

  color:white;

}



.margin_auto{

  margin:auto;

}



.left{

  text-align:left;

  margin-left:10px;

}

.right{

  text-align:right;

  margin-right:10px

}



table.editaceObjednavkyAdresy{margin-left:55px}



table.sumar{border:1px solid black;

margin:auto;

text-align:center;

width:86%}

table.sumar td{text-align:right;}

table.sumar td.blue{  font-weight:bold;

  background-color: #245F8E;

  color:white;}

